What is Atana?

Atana
EducationTraining

Atana, formerly known as Media Partners, is a company focused on delivering engaging, award-winning content coupled with detailed analytics to track user intent and drive positive organizational outcomes. The company specializes in workplace training designed to foster measurable and lasting behavior change. Its core offerings include training modules on Workplace Communication, equipping managers to handle sensitive issues with respect; Respectful Workplaces, aimed at creating safe environments free from harassment and discrimination; Diversity & Inclusion (D&I), promoting awareness and behavior change around unconscious bias and microaggressions; and Workplace Safety, enabling employees to identify and address potential threats. This comprehensive approach positions Atana as a key player in corporate culture and employee development.

How much funding has Atana raised?

Atana has raised a total of $13.1M across 4 funding rounds:

Unspecified (2017): $1.1M with participation from Alliance of Angels

Other Financing Round (2019): $5.6M, investors not publicly disclosed

Debt (2020): $350K supported by PPP

Series A (2023): $6M featuring Alliance of Angels

Key Investors in Atana

Alliance of Angels

Alliance of Angels is a prominent angel investor network based in Seattle, focusing on providing startup funding and seed-stage investments to early-stage companies, particularly in the Pacific Northwest technology, hardware, consumer, and life sciences sectors. They aim to support entrepreneurs in transforming innovative ideas into successful businesses.
